It's as simple as reading the headline.

If it reads something like..

" Watch X get blasted by Y"
" X loses it and goes on a rampage over y's remarks"
" You should care about X and here's why!"
" X is coming for your Y!"

The goal of media is to keep subs and followers. They have a vested interest in it to survive.
These conglomerates wear their bias on their sleeve proudly. It's a Marketing gimmick.

When you know for sure that an article from HuffPo will be anti-Trump/pro-left and
you know for sure that a Breitbart article will be anti-Left pro-Right,..

how can you honestly take them seriously?!

It's like when flat -earther's cite theWorldisFlat..com as some definitive evidence. Really? What did you think they were gonna say?!


Our only hope is to aggregate many sources. Stop knee-jerk reacting.

Stop immediately liking and sharing based on toxic headlines to 'own' each other.

Half the 'debate' online is in the form of shared links from 'Influencers' on twitter. It's ridiculous.
